Então Surian, desculpe a demora, é que esse final de semana dei uma
desligada..! hehe

mas seguinte eu uso o framework Swiz na minha aplicação, mas a parte
de fazer a comunicação é executada da mesma forma
apenas o que muda é que eu crio um Bean dedicado a essa comunicação
com o java e através do Swiz eu uso ele na aplicação...

mas neste Bean eu tenho:

<s:RemoteObject id="remote" destination="usuarioService"
                                                showBusyCursor="true"
                                                fault="onFault(event)"/>

e desta forma esta rodando redondinho, antes eu criava um channel na
unha, setava porta e o contexto e dava problema para acessar
de outras máquinas, mas agora apenas com o RemoteObject esta legal,
acesso de outras máquinas e comunico com o java(back-end) sem
problemas!!!

Quanto ao seu problema da uma olhada na sua comunicação e também nas
suas classes espelho no flex se estão corretamente configurados os
caminhos:

[Bindable]
        [RemoteClass(alias="com.santos.business.vo.Usuario")]
        public class UsuarioVO
        {
                public var idUsuario:Number;
                public var nome:String;
                public var username:String;
                public var senha:String;
                public var email:String;
        }




On Jul 1, 4:52 pm, SuriaN <[email protected]> wrote:
> Meu caso é o seguinte rodo minha aplicação no tomcat usando o blazeds
> para comunicar minha aplicação flex 3 com o java, localmente executo
> de boa, porém quando faço o deploy no servidor que a empresa usa da um
> erro de "Send Failed" ao tentar fazer a comunicação com o java através
> do login, se possivel mostre o que você fez ai quem sabe não é o mesmo
> problema que o meu, flw!
>
> On 1 jul, 16:21, Jeferson Santos <[email protected]> wrote:
>
>
>
>
>
>
>
> > Então Fabio, no meu caso refatorando o código eu descobri que era
> > problema com o meu --channel--,
>
> > mudei a forma de comunicar e funcionou blz, mas gostei da sua ideia de
> > trocar pelo messageBroker para não se preocupar com o server e porta,
>
> > ainda vou testar da sua forma também... mas vlw pela dica!!!
>
> > Adeildo eu também quero testar e estudar mais o Jboss, o problema é
> > que estou meio sem tempo, mas gostaria de me dedicar a ele também,
>
> > pois é um ótimo server e com muitas funcionalidades bacanas... quando
> > for testar se for usar o crossdomain.xml lembrarei da sua dica, vlw ..
>
> > Surian, quando tiver tempo cara da uma olhada na sua forma de
> > comunicação(no seu channel), ou segue a dica da galera ai que
> > provavelmente seu problema estará resolvido...
> > se não der posta ai algum log de erro que gera pra gente dar uma
> > olhada.
>
> > Obrigado a todos pela ajuda!! abraço
>
> > Problema Resolvido com sucesso!
>
> > On Jun 27, 1:40 pm, fabiophx <[email protected]> wrote:
>
> > > Jeferson,
> > >    Normalmente faço assim:
> > > <endpoint url="{context.root}/messagebroker/amf"
> > > class="flex.messaging.endpoints.AMFEndpoint"/>
> > >    Com isso não me preocupo com server nem porta só o contexto.
>
> > > []s
> > > Fabio da Silvahttp://fabiophx.blogspot.com/
>
> > > On Jun 24, 9:23 am, Jeferson Santos <[email protected]> wrote:
>
> > > > Fala galera, estou com alguns probleminhas aqui para fazer a
> > > > publicação de uma app minha no tomcat. O que esta ocorrendo é o
> > > > seguinte: faço o deploy do ".war" da app no tomcat normalmente, mas
> > > > quando alguém conectado a minha rede interna tenta acessar minha app
> > > > ocorre um erro já ao tentar fazer o login:
> > > > "faultCode:Client.Error.MessageSend faultString:'Falha no envio'
> > > > faultDetail:'Channel.Security.Error error Error #2048: Violação da
> > > > área de segurança:http://192.168.1.127:8080/Supe-java/debug/Main.swf
> > > > não pode carregar dados 
> > > > dehttp://localhost:8080/Supe-java/messagebroker/amf.
> > > > url: 'http://localhost:8080/Supe-java/messagebroker/amf'', li alguns
> > > > artigos sobre configurar um "crossDomain.xml"  liberando acesso, porém
> > > > achei muitos conflitos de informação para aonde vai ficar o
> > > > "crossDomain.xml" alguns dizem na raiz do servidor, outros em uma
> > > > pasta na app, ai se for escolhido coloca-lo em uma pasta na app é
> > > > necessário setar o local (apontar aonde foi posto o arquivo .xml), mas
> > > > já fiz vários testes de várias formas e continuo com o mesmo problema.
> > > > Alguém já teve esse mesmo problema e conseguiu resolve-lo de alguma
> > > > forma ? lembrando que rodando dentro do eclipse a app roda beleza.
>
> > > > Abraço galera.

-- 
Você recebeu esta mensagem porque está inscrito na lista "flexdev"
Para enviar uma mensagem, envie um e-mail para [email protected]
Para sair da lista, envie um email em branco para 
[email protected]
Mais opções estão disponíveis em http://groups.google.com/group/flexdev

Responder a